What Are Architectural Shingles?
Building tiles, commonly called dimensional tiles, are a popular roof selection for home owners seeking both style and longevity. Unlike traditional 3-tab shingles, building tiles feature a split style that develops a distinctive appearance. This added measurement not just enhances your home's visual charm yet additionally simulates the look of a lot more costly products, such as wood or slate.

Furthermore, architectural tiles boast a longer life expectancy contrasted to typical choices, making them a clever investment. Their weight and thickness offer extra security against wind and rain, offering you comfort. When you select architectural shingles, you're incorporating looks with useful advantages for your home.

Maintenance Tips for Architectural Tiles
To maintain your architectural shingles in top shape, routine upkeep is important. Look for loose or broken tiles, as well as any kind of signs of algae or moss growth.
Next, clean your rain gutters routinely to ensure appropriate water drain. Stopped up seamless additional resources gutters can bring about water merging on your roof, which can harm your shingles in time. You can also gently wash your shingles with a blend of water and light detergent to remove dust and algae, however avoid high-pressure washing, as it can remove tiles.
Finally, consider trimming overhanging branches to stop debris build-up and enable sunshine to dry your roof covering. By following these easy steps, you'll aid extend the life of your architectural shingles and preserve your home's visual appeal.

Price Comparison Analysis
While you might be drawn to the visual appeal of building shingles, it's essential to review exactly how their prices stack up against various other roofing products. Normally, architectural tiles fall in the mid-range rate group, costing in between $90 and $100 per square. On the other hand, typical 3-tab roof shingles are extra affordable, balancing $70 to $80 per square. Steel roof, on the other hand, can vary from $100 to $300 per square, depending upon the materials used. That might establish you back $300 or more per square if you're taking into consideration floor tile roof covering. Evaluating these prices against the life expectancy and upkeep requirements of each choice can aid you make a more enlightened decision that straightens with your budget plan and visual preferences.
Long Life and Toughness
Price is simply one variable to ponder in your roofing choice; longevity and longevity play important roles too (architectural shingles). Architectural shingles generally last 25 to thirty years, outmatching typical asphalt tiles, which might just give you around 15 to two decades. Their multi-layered layout boosts their stamina, making them a lot more resistant to severe weather condition conditions, including wind and hail storm
When you contrast them to metal roofing, which can last up to half a century, building roof shingles might appear much less long lasting. They provide a great equilibrium of expense and durability. Ultimately, picking building shingles suggests buying a trustworthy choice that stands the test of time, guaranteeing your home stays protected without requiring regular replacements.
